2021 Fall Training

We are proud to offer a 10-week fall training program this year for players 2004 through to 2014.

[REGISTRATION FORM CLOSED]

Players will be run through drills that encompass all aspects of this great game, including fielding, pitching, hitting, base-running and various games to improve our tools!

This year’s WRSSBA Fall Training is overseen by Jordan Broatch, Director of Baseball Operations & Player Development. Jordan’s main responsibility is to promote a positive learning environment where youth have an opportunity to enjoy baseball while experiencing new skills and coaching by our group of impressive baseball instructors.

Intro or Advanced?

  • Choose Intro if your player is new to pitching (under 1 year), new to baseball, or has limited experience
  • Choose Advanced if your player has more than one year experience pitching at the higher level of their division (11U Mosquito American League or 13U Peewee AA)

Session Times

Fall Training sessions are based on BC Minor player ages (i.e., birth year), and thus the sessions are based on the player’s Spring 2022 division. For example, a player born in 2010 who played second year Mosquito in 2021 will register for Peewee as he will be a Peewee player in 2022.

Tadpole: 2013, 2014
Mosquito: 2011, 2012
Peewee:
2009, 2010
Bantam and Midget:
2004, 2005, 2006, 2007, 2008
